hi all. it's not often i ask for technical help but this time i'm really confused :?
i've just fitted cruise control to my iS racebus and it's all gone well up until the final job of plugging in the 2 pin plug to the connector block behind the glovebox. the space is there but there are no pins :(
the wire colours on the plug are red/green and purple/white.
i assume they are just brake circuit and power but does anyone know which does what or where else i can tap into?
has anyone come up with this before?
i've never had any problems on the ones i've fitted before i just assumed they were all the same.

typical isn't it when it was a quick 20 min job before i go home.
my car was originally a 1990 318i auto touring.

i've sussed it! :woohoo:
green/red is brake signal
purple/white is 12v ignition live.
sorted!
Typically my car is the only one i've found without the pins there but hopefully this will be of some use to someone somewhere :thumb:

Very strange the pins are missing! the purple/white should connect to purple/green in the car, which is the live feed to the brake light switch.
I.e. The two wires you need are the two that go to the brake light switch.

Brian i also have a blue/brown single wire i have a auto gearbox where shall i connect this and to which colour wire?

It connects to a green/black that goes from the starter inhibitor switch on your gearbox selector to the starter inhibitor relay in the glovebox area.
